Things to do in Smithfield?
Smithfield, Rhode Island lies within Providence County and is popular among those looking to get away from the hustle and bustle of city life without having to go too far. This charming town has a population of around 22,000 individuals and boasts a distinctly rural atmosphere with plenty of green spaces dotted throughout it. Smithfield provides easy access to top notch recreational facilities such as Waterman Reservoir Park where visitors can enjoy beautiful views or engage in leisure activities such as fishing or biking along its trails!
Things to do in Berkeley Heights?
Berkeley Heights, NJ is a vibrant town northeast of Newark boasting a variety of landmarks such as Cooper Gristmill showcasing traditional milling techniques or Passaic River Parks perfect for biking and fishing; their yearly event Berkeley Heights Strawberry Festival celebrates local traditions with music and art every May.
